Manchester United manager Ruben Amorim has conceded he is unsure how long it will take his side to reach the standards set by Premier League champions Liverpool, ahead of Sunday’s landmark 100th meeting between the two rivals at Anfield.

United endured their worst Premier League campaign last season, finishing 15th, while Liverpool equalled their record of 20 league titles, underlining the widening gulf between the clubs. Despite the history and intensity of English football’s most storied rivalry, Amorim acknowledged that United’s rebuilding process remains a long-term project, speaking to Sky Sports.

I don’t know how long it will take,” Amorim admitted. “Sometimes things change really fast. We can win any game, that’s how we have to think. The most important thing is the next match, and we will fight to reach Liverpool’s level in the future.”

The Portuguese coach, who arrived at Old Trafford last November, has faced growing scrutiny amid United’s inconsistent form. Yet his message ahead of the trip to Anfield was one of patience and persistence, emphasising small steps rather than sweeping promises.
